Embakasi East MP Babu Owino has publicly distanced himself from online attacks targeting Mama Ida Odinga, amid speculation linking him to posts by blogger Maverick Aoko.
Taking to social media, Babu clarified that he has no role in Aoko’s commentary, emphasising that she operates independently.
“Maverick Aoko is my friend and my fierce supporter, for which I’m truly grateful and appreciative. Oftentimes, when she posts on X, people are under the impression that I am the one who tells her what to post,” he began.
“Maverick is an independent-minded person. I do not know her sources and have never told her to attack the Odinga family,” he stated.
Highlighting his close personal relationship with the Odinga family, Babu said his bond with Raila Odinga’s children—Winnie, Junior, and Rosemary— was strong, insisting it would be unthinkable for him to insult Mama Ida.
“Mama Ida loves me like her own son, welcomes me home, and gives me food whenever I visit her. I can never insult such a mum. She’s been good to me, and I love her,” he added.
To reinforce his message, Owino shared a selfie previously taken with Mama Ida during a flight, a gesture aimed at quelling speculation and reaffirming mutual respect.

Who is Aoko?
Maverick Aoko, whose real name is Scophine Aoko Otieno, is a Kenyan social media personality, blogger, political activist, and journalist known for her outspoken and often controversial views on politics and social issues.
A major source of controversy is her frequent arrests and legal battles, particularly over alleged cyber harassment and publishing false information on her social media handles, leading to her being charged in court and released on bail.
Additionally, she has garnered attention for her strong political opinions, including sharp criticism of the current government, and for her outspoken stance on social issues like advocating for men’s rights and castigating feminism.
In October 2024, she was allegedly arrested and went missing for two weeks before being found at the Kenya-Tanzania border, an incident that sparked concern.
